在用 nvm 管理多个 node 环境时确实方便,但有时在安装的时候会遇到这种情况:
出现这个问题大多是因为是 windows 原因(具体不明,git issue 中作者这么说的)
那么怎么办呢?
手动安装
去这里下载一个对应版本的安装包:
比如我要安装 12 版本,就找到对应的文件夹,然后下载 zip 格式的内容:
解压后,安装到 nvm 根目录下。
根目录可以通过命令:
nvm root
来查看。
直接新建一个名为 v12.22.12
的文件夹,然后将 zip 中所有文件解压到这里。
此时再看 nvm ls,对应的版本已经出现在了列表里:
无法删除
除了无法正常安装,有时遇到安装失败后,我们想通过 nvm uninstall xxx
去卸载的时候,却发现无法正常卸载。此时只需要在 nvm 的根目录下删除对应版本文件夹即可。
文章评论